    Exploring the City of Light: Things to Do in Paris

    0
    By Editme on November 28, 2023 Things to Do, Travel
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n WhatsApp Pinterest Email

    Paris, often referred to as the ‘Light City’, is a treasure trove of art, culture and history. With its iconic sights, charming world-class streets and dishes, Paris offers countless experiences for every type of traveler. Whether you are a history buff, a foodie or an art lover, the French capital has something to captivate your heart. In this guide we explore a composite list of things to do in Paris so that your visit is filled with unforgettable moments.

     

    1. Discover the timeless beauty of the Eiffel Tower

    No trip to Paris is complete without a visit to the Eiffel Tower. Synonymous with the city, this iconic structure stands high against the Paris skyline. Start your journey by taking a lift or climbing the stairs to the top for breathtaking panoramic views of the city. If you are looking for a romantic experience, plan your visit in the evening when the tower shines with thousands of lights. The Eiffel Tower is not just a landmark; it is a symbol of romance and elegance that should be on everyone’s list of things to do in Paris.

    2. Louvre Museum: a haven for art lovers

    The Louvre Museum is a must-visit destination for those with a passion for art and history. The Louvre houses thousands of works of art, including the world-famous Mona Lisa, and is a treasure trove of cultural heritage. Spend hours wandering through the great halls and marvel at masterpieces from different eras and cultures. To get the most out of your visit, consider a guided tour to understand the significance of each exhibition. The Louvre is a testament to human creativity and is undoubtedly one of the best things to do in Paris for art lovers.

    3. Stroll through the charming streets of Montmartre

    Escape the hustle and bustle of the city center by exploring the bohemian charm of Montmartre. Located on a hill, this artistic neighborhood has historically been a haven for painters, writers and musicians. Wander through narrow cobbled streets, discover quirky art studios and enjoy the lively atmosphere of the Place du Tertre, where local artists display their work. Don’t forget to visit the iconic Basilique du Sacré-Cœur for a panoramic view of Paris. Montmartre offers a unique blend of creativity and history, making it a delightful addition to your list of things to do in Paris.

    1. Café culture: enjoy and taste the Parisian way

    Embrace the typical Parisian experience by spending a relaxing afternoon in one of the city’s charming cafes. Enjoy a cup of rich espresso or a glass of wine as you watch the world go by. The terraces along the River Seine provide a picturesque environment, perfect for people watching and immersing yourself in the relaxed Parisian lifestyle. This simple yet wonderful activity should be on every traveler’s list of things to do in Paris.

    2. Gourmet adventure in Le Marais

    For a culinary adventure, head to the historic Le Marais district. This trendy neighborhood is a melting pot of flavors and offers a wide range of dining options, from traditional French bistros to international dishes. Explore the bustling food markets, enjoy delicious pastries from local bakeries and enjoy the varied culinary offer. Le Marais is a gourmet paradise and a perfect addition to your gastronomic journey through the city.

    3. Dining with a Michelin star: a culinary extravaganza

    Improve your dining experience by trying a meal at one of the Michelin-starred restaurants in Paris. With an overcrowded range of options to choose from, you can treat your taste buds to exquisite French dishes prepared by some of the world’s best chefs. While it may be a splurge, the culinary masterpieces and impeccable service make it a unique experience. Adding a Michelin-star restaurant to your list of things to do in Paris will undoubtedly create lasting memories of your visit.

    Navigating the River Seine: A Romantic Intermezzo

    The River Seine, which flows gracefully through the heart of Paris, adds a touch of romance to the city. Start a cruise on the Seine and witness the enchanting beauty of Paris, illuminated at night.

    1. Sunset Cruise: A Romantic Prelude

    Start your evening with a sunset cruise along the River Seine. Watch the sun drop below the horizon and cast a warm glow on the sights of the city. Many operators offer dinner cruises and offer a romantic setting for couples. Enjoy a gourmet meal as you cruise past iconic sights such as Notre-Dame and Louvre. A cruise on the Seine is a romantic and enchanting experience that should be on every couple’s list of things to do in Paris.

    2. Notre-Dame Cathedral: a Gothic masterpiece

    Although the exterior of Notre-Dame Cathedral is a feast for the eyes, the interior is just as captivating. Explore the intricate Gothic architecture, climb to the top for a panoramic view of Paris and learn about the cathedral’s rich history. Although restoration work is underway after the devastating fire in 2019, a visit to Notre-Dame remains a poignant and historically important experience.

    3. Champs-Élysées and Arc de Triomphe: shopping and walking

    Enjoy some shopping therapy along the Champs-Élysées, one of the most famous boulevards in the world. dotted with designer boutiques, cafes and theaters, this large boulevard is a shopping paradise. On the west side you will find the iconic Arc de Triomphe. Take a leisurely walk, shop for luxury goods and admire the triumphal arch, a lasting symbol of French pride. Exploring the Champs-Élysées and the Arc de Triomphe is a glamorous addition to your list of things to do in Paris.
